Characterization of Stimulatory Action on Voltage-Gated Na<sup>+</sup> Currents Caused by Omecamtiv Mecarbil, Known to Be a Myosin Activator
Omecamtiv mecarbil (OM, CK-1827452) is recognized as an activator of myosin and has been demonstrated to be beneficial for the treatment of systolic heart failure. However, the mechanisms by which this compound interacts with ionic currents in electrically excitable cells remain largely unknown. The...
